Output e66e43a1ba6f5cd802f77916a8b9fc156b2fdf9e9b3d9c9369cdbc3bfc89dcc3:3

value
625
script pubkey
OP_0 OP_PUSHBYTES_20 dfb943938cdf0937d9cb3b9ce8263bd1b14dc9d0
address
tb1qm7u58yuvmuyn0kwt8wwwsf3m6xc5mjws4mku0h
transaction
e66e43a1ba6f5cd802f77916a8b9fc156b2fdf9e9b3d9c9369cdbc3bfc89dcc3